Subject:
Monitor Horizontal lines problem
Category: Computers Asked by: wschloss-ga List Price: $5.00 |
Posted:
21 Jun 2005 07:39 PDT
Expires: 21 Jul 2005 07:39 PDT Question ID: 535451 |
Hi, I have a Dell optiplex running win 2000 with an EIZO Flexscan T561 monitor (17"). Lately I have horizontal shadow lines appearing on screen. These move with the window when I drag windows around. The following has not helped: virus scan with latest Trend Micro updates, Windows update, unload and reload of drivers from Win update site (this monitor is 5-6 yrs old but I use Windows power management to turn it off after 1/2 hour when not in use). I thought maybe just time for new, but I have a spare of the exact same monitor (given from previous job was replacing with flats) and same thing happens. Reseated the monitor cable on CPU and back of monitor, still same. Cold reboot, same thing. Went to EIZO site but did not find drivers for this monitor. I tried changing refresh rates, color settings . . . no dice. The adaptor is an NVidia Riva TNT2Model 64 integrated RAMDAC with 8mb memory, adaptor string NV5 bios version 2.05.1704 the Microsoft driver date is from 9/30/1999. Nothing new has been loaded on this computer recently. SPybot S&D is running and Startup inspector shows nothing too weird starting up. My wife likes Roller coaster tycoon, which is a bit funky w video but has been on this machine for over 2 years without problems and the problem is with ALL apps/programs. Please, not ready to trash this machine. |

Subject:
Re: Monitor Horizontal lines problem
From: kjean-ga on 21 Jun 2005 14:10 PDT |
There is probably nothing wrong with your monitors. The problem is with your graphics card. The RAMDAC on your card is broken and is leaking current from previous pixels. My suggestion is to replace your graphics card with another one. |
Subject:
Re: Monitor Horizontal lines problem
From: bschonec-ga on 24 Jun 2005 12:04 PDT |
I concur. Nearly every Gateway PC that I have here at work had the exact issue you describe. Changing the video card fixed the problem. |
